Post by TheDieselTrain on Jun 10, 2007 19:50:47 GMT -5
I can't figure out why Edge is using it at all. At about what time, exactly, did he start using the Spear as a finisher? I was watching some old Raw tapes from 2000 and even back then as part of the Edge/Christian duo, he was using it. He actually 1st to my knowledge did it at the 1999 KOTR. Still have it on PPV so I remember it well. The Hardy's did thier move where matts on his knees and jeff hops off matts back and leg lariats someone (The name of the move escapes me for some reason) Instead of getting caught with it Edge hopped to the 2nd turn buckle and speared the crap outta jeff hardy. The crowd popped for it big. Even though the Brood lost they showed the spear a few times after the match and showed it again the next night on RAW.

Post by Fortunato on Jun 11, 2007 12:14:59 GMT -5
Now then... I've seen several people say that Edge's Spears aren't executed right or look strange. At least one person referred to it as the "running hug." I concede I haven't paid enough attention to examine it closely or compare it to the Spear as executed by one of the 168 other guys who currently have it as a part of their regular moveset. So what, exactly, is the matter with it? What's he doing wrong? Anybody have videos or something for comparison? The problem is the lack of power andextension. When Goldberg hit the move, he would add extra power to it by pushing off with his toes just before impact. When Goldberg hit his opponent, Goldberg's entire body would be completely airborn and nearly parallel with the mat. He entirely committed to the move, and it looked devastating as a result. Conversely, Edge just kind of falls into the other guy, and his knees hit the mat before his opponent does.
